Olivier Adams and Praga Khan are also known for their work on Mortal Kombat: The Album, based on the controversial video game performing as The Immortals Jade 4U provided backing vocals on the track "Kano (Use Your Might)"

Lords of Acid also performed under the pseudonyms Channel X, Digital Orgasm and 101, with a less sex-based and more rave-influenced sound.

Lords of Acid made a cameo appearance in an adult pornographic film 54, performing "Finger Lickin' Good", "Stripper" and "Stoned on Love Again".

Lords of Acid has also explored various other genres of music such as hip hop and R&B, disco, rap, pop, jazz, Latin, reggae, folk and country.

Although being named the "Queen of New Beat", Jade 4U had expressed her distaste for the genre in the beginning.

Co-founder Olivier Adams is the heir to the Stella Artois beer fortune.
